DSC Light Comming on Randomly

The Dynamic Stability Control light (the one right in the middle of the dash) has came on a few times randomly. It doesn't blink like a light bulb going out; it stays on for a second or two. It doesn't seem to come on much at all - just once or twice every few days. Also, nothing seems to trigger it that I've found: i.e. it doesn't just come on when I hit a pot hole.

Anyone have any idea what the cause may be? I'm thinking it might have something to do with the suspension. But shocks, struts, etc. seems good as new. If it was a short in the wires, it would come on and off more often than it does.

If it flashes a few times randomly that is what it is supposed to do when it activates. Are you sure you weren't taking a sharp corner where the rear wheel got unloaded enough to slip a bit? Or was it raining? Mine comes on sometimes for those reasons.
